Investors are growing more worried about retail

American retailers have shed jobs on an annual basis for the first time since 2010

The latest US  jobs report laid bare some of the sobering tribulations faced by American retailers: they’ve shed jobs on an annual basis for the first time since 2010, when the sector’s employment was just starting to rebound following the Great Recession. 

The challenges are mounting as Amazon.com  continues to grab market share in a secular trend in favour of e-commerce at the same time that cyclical consumption, the engine of US  growth, may be sputtering.
